# Heads up, plugin authors: this env file drives the font-vendoring step for the Quillbark theme kit.
# We mirror third-party typefaces into our own bundle so your plugins never fetch from the wild at runtime.
# Don't rename the FONT_CACHE_DIR or the mirror script will happily re-download everything on every build.
# Keep the mirror host pointed at the Dunmere relay unless you enjoy slow CI.
# The mirror won't authenticate without its access token, which goes on the very next line.

env line for fafof-fahag: LEDGER_TOKEN5=f8790

## Ostrand Plant Capacity Decision (Managers Only)

Quick summary for finance: we're leaning toward adding a second line at the Ostrand plant rather than outsourcing to Kelviro. Payback looks like roughly three years, assuming Tervane demand holds. Capex figures go into next month's forecast, so flag any concerns early. The confidential note below outlines how this fits the broader business plan.

confidential, bahap-bajog: Zorethix Works is in early talks to buy Kelethox Foods for about $30.7 million. The Ralvan launch date is September 19, and nothing goes to the press before then.

Minutes – Regional Sales Review, Orvaine Holdings

Present: K. Delmas (chair), F. Arnoux, S. Pellwright.

The Westmere region delivered 103% of target, supported by strong uptake of the Solvane product suite. Easthaven underperformed at 89%, attributed to delayed onboarding of two distributors. Arnoux will prepare a corrective plan within ten days. Department heads are asked to review staffing alignment carefully. The confidential note on business plans follows immediately below.

board note of kaguf-hagug: Only 36 of the 386 pilot accounts renewed Julax, so a churn review is set for August 11. Fravanox Partners is in early talks to buy Jorirek Group for about $450.0 million.